Understanding Water Pressure

Before diving into effective solutions, it’s important to understand what water pressure is and how it affects your garden hose. Water pressure is the force at which water travels through pipes, typically measured in pounds per square inch (psi). A standard garden hose may operate optimally at a range of 40-60 psi. If the pressure drops below this level, your hose flow will be weak and ineffective.

Several factors can contribute to low water pressure, including municipal supply limitations, the length of the hose, and obstructions within the hose itself. With an understanding of pressure dynamics, we can now explore ways to enhance the flow of water through your garden hose.

Simple Solutions to Increase Water Pressure

When faced with low water pressure, there are a variety of straightforward approaches. Here are some effective ways to maximize your garden hose water pressure:

1. Check the Hose for Kinks and Tears

One of the most common culprits of low water pressure is a kinked or damaged hose. A simple kink can block water flow, leading to decreased pressure.

  • Inspect for Kinks: Regularly examine your hose during use. If you notice any twists or kinks, straighten them to restore proper water flow.
  • Look for Tears or Holes: Even small defects can lead to significant water loss. Patch up minor leaks with repair tape or replace the hose if the damage is extensive.

2. Use a Pressure Boosting System

For gardeners who frequently experience poor water pressure, investing in a water pressure boosting system may be a worthy solution. These devices pump water from your existing supply and enhance its pressure before it reaches your hose.

  • Types of Boosting Systems: You can find different types of pressure-boosting systems, including inline pressure pumps and tank systems.
  • Professional Installation: Consider hiring a professional for installation, ensuring that the system is set up correctly for optimal performance.

Optimize Your Hose Setup

The way you set up your garden hose can significantly impact water pressure. Here are some tips for optimizing your hose:

1. Shorten the Length of the Hose

Long hoses can reduce water pressure due to friction losses. If you’re grappling with low pressure, consider using a shorter hose or creating a closer connection to the water source.

2. Use a Larger Diameter Hose

Hoses come in different diameters, usually measured in inches. A larger diameter hose allows for greater water flow and can help increase pressure. If your current hose has a small diameter, upgrading to a larger hose can yield noticeable results.

3. Ensure Proper Connections

Check that your hose is tightly connected to the faucet. Loose connections can result in leaks that diminish water pressure. Use Teflon tape on the threads of the hose to seal any gaps.

Maintain Your Hose Regularly

Regular maintenance is essential for keeping your garden hose in optimal condition. Neglecting maintenance can lead to a buildup of debris and mineral deposits that impede water flow.

1. Clean the Hose Periodically

Over time, garden hoses can accumulate minerals and debris. Flushing your hose periodically can remove these blockages. Here’s how:

  1. Detach the hose from the spigot.
  2. Run water through the hose until the water runs clear.
  3. If necessary, use a combination of vinegar and baking soda to clean stubborn buildup.

2. Store the Hose Properly

Improper storage of your garden hose can lead to kinks, cracks, and other forms of damage. Always store your hose in a cool, dry place and consider using a reel to prevent tangling.

Alternative Solutions for Enhanced Pressure

If you have tried the basic solutions and still face water pressure issues, consider some more advanced options:

1. Upgrade Your Water Source

Sometimes, the issue lies with your water source rather than the hose itself. If your home’s water pressure is inherently low due to municipal supply issues, think about upgrading your plumbing system. Consult with a licensed plumber about options such as installing a pressure booster before the water reaches your hose.

2. Install a Pressure Regulator

While pressure regulators are typically used to decrease water pressure, they can also help stabilize fluctuating pressure levels. By maintaining consistent pressure, you can experience better flow through your garden hose.

3. Use Nozzles and Attachments

Investing in high-quality nozzle attachments can help direct the water flow and create a stronger spray. Look for adjustable nozzles that let you control the pressure settings according to your needs.

Consider Environmental Factors

Sometimes low water pressure can stem from environmental factors rather than equipment. Here are some elements to assess:

1. Seasonal Changes

During dry seasons, municipal water supply lines may be under strain, leading to lowered water pressure. Consider timing your watering schedule to less busy times, such as early morning or later in the evening, when water demand is lower.

2. Water Source Type

If you’re using a rain barrel or a well, limitations in those water sources can impact pressure. Ensure your collection systems can maintain adequate water levels and consider supplemental systems like pumps or larger barrels to optimize flow.

Choosing Quality Equipment

Selecting high-quality hoses and fittings is crucial for longevity and performance. Investing in reputable brands can often mean better materials that resist damages and leaks.

1. Selecting the Right Hose

When purchasing a new garden hose, opt for a durable material that suits your watering needs. Rubber hoses often withstand pressure better than vinyl hoses, making them suitable for heavy use.

2. Opt for Quality Accessories

Using reliable fittings, connectors, and nozzles can significantly improve the performance of your garden hose. Ensure they fit securely and are made from corrosion-resistant materials.

What causes low water pressure in garden hoses?

Low water pressure in garden hoses can be attributed to several factors, including plumbing issues, hose diameter, or even the water source itself. If the municipal water supply has low pressure, it will directly affect the water flow through your hose. Additionally, if there are blockages in the hose or the fittings, this can also be a significant contributor to reduced water pressure.

Another common cause might be the length of the hose. Longer hoses tend to experience more friction, which can lead to pressure drops as the water travels through. Furthermore, hoses that are too narrow can restrict the flow of water, resulting in lower pressure at the nozzle. It’s essential to identify these factors to effectively address the problem.

How can I check my water pressure before troubleshooting?

You can check the water pressure in your garden hose by using a pressure gauge. This device can be attached directly to the end of the hose, allowing you to measure the water pressure accurately. A typical range for garden hoses is between 40 to 60 PSI. If your reading falls significantly below that range, it’s a sign that there may be an issue with either the water source or the hose itself.

If you don’t have a pressure gauge, you can also conduct a simple test by running the hose for a set amount of time and measuring how much water comes out. For instance, a standard garden hose should fill a five-gallon bucket within a couple of minutes. This method gives a rough estimate of the water flow and can provide insights into whether you have a pressure problem or just low flow.

What types of hoses are best for higher water pressure?

Choosing the right type of hose can significantly affect water pressure. A hose with a larger diameter allows more water to flow through, which can help maintain pressure. For instance, a 5/8-inch diameter hose is generally recommended for optimal performance, as it can better withstand higher pressures compared to narrower hoses.

Additionally, look for hoses made from materials designed to minimize friction. High-quality rubber hoses typically offer better flexibility and can endure higher water pressures without kinking. Additionally, reinforced hoses that feature multiple layers can provide extra durability against wear and tear that could affect pressure over time.

Are there any gardening techniques that can help with low pressure?

Certain gardening techniques can help mitigate the impacts of low water pressure. One effective method is to use soaker hoses or drip irrigation systems. These methods allow water to seep directly into the soil, ensuring that even with lower pressure, your plants receive adequate water. They are efficient and minimize water waste while promoting better moisture retention in the soil.

Furthermore, consider arranging your garden in a way that allows gravity and natural drainage to work in your favor. For instance, planting on a slope can help direct water to lower areas, improving moisture distribution. Combining these techniques with effective watering schedules can further ensure your garden remains healthy, despite any challenges posed by low water pressure.
